En redes informáticas , IP over Avian Carriers ( IPoAC ) es una propuesta de broma para transportar tráfico de Protocolo de Internet (IP) por aves como las palomas mensajeras . IP over Avian Carriers se describió inicialmente en RFC 1149 emitido por Internet Engineering Task Force , escrito por David Waitzman y publicado el 1 de abril de 1990. Es una de varias solicitudes de comentarios del Día de los Inocentes .
Waitzman describió una mejora de su protocolo en el RFC 2549, IP over Avian Carriers with Quality of Service (1 de abril de 1999). Más tarde, en el RFC 6214 (publicado el 1 de abril de 2011 y 13 años después de la introducción de IPv6 ), Brian Carpenter y Robert Hinden publicaron Adaptation of RFC 1149 for IPv6 (Adaptación del RFC 1149 para IPv6) . [1]
IPoAC se ha implementado con éxito, pero sólo para nueve paquetes de datos , con una tasa de pérdida de paquetes del 55% (debido a errores del operador), [2] y un tiempo de respuesta que varía de 3.000 segundos (50 min) a más de 6.000 segundos (100 min). Por lo tanto, esta tecnología sufre de una alta latencia . [3]
El 28 de abril de 2001, el grupo de usuarios de Bergen Linux implementó IPoAC bajo el nombre CPIP (por Carrier Pigeon Internet Protocol). [4] Enviaron nueve paquetes a una distancia de aproximadamente 5 km (3 mi), cada uno transportado por una paloma individual y que contenía un ping ( solicitud de eco ICMP ), y recibieron cuatro respuestas.
El guión se inició el sábado 28 de abril de 2001 a las 11:24:09$ /sbin/ifconfig tun0tun0 Encapsulado de enlace: Protocolo punto a punto dirección inet:10.0.3.2 PtP:10.0.3.1 Máscara:255.255.255.255 PUNTO A PUNTO EN EJECUCIÓN MULTIDIFUSIÓN NOARP MTU:150 Métrica:1 Paquetes RX: 1 errores: 0 descartados: 0 desbordamientos: 0 tramas: 0 Paquetes TX: 2 errores: 0 descartados: 0 desbordamientos: 0 portadora: 0 colisiones:0 Bytes de recepción: 88 (88,0 b) Bytes de transmisión: 168 (168,0 b)$ping -c 9 -i 900 10.0.3.1PING 10.0.3.1 (10.0.3.1): 56 bytes de datos64 bytes de 10.0.3.1: icmp_seq=0 ttl=255 tiempo=6165731.1 ms64 bytes de 10.0.3.1: icmp_seq=4 ttl=255 tiempo=3211900.8 ms64 bytes de 10.0.3.1: icmp_seq=2 ttl=255 tiempo=5124922.8 ms64 bytes de 10.0.3.1: icmp_seq=1 ttl=255 tiempo=6388671.9 ms--- Estadísticas de ping 10.0.3.1 ---9 paquetes transmitidos, 4 paquetes recibidos, 55% pérdida de paquetesida y vuelta mín./promedio/máx. = 3211900,8/5222806,6/6388671,9 msGuión realizado el sábado 28 de abril de 2001 a las 14:14:28
Esta implementación en la vida real fue mencionada por la miembro del parlamento francés Martine Billard en la Asamblea Nacional Francesa , [5] durante los debates sobre HADOPI .
En diciembre de 2005, un informe de Gartner sobre la gripe aviar que concluía que "una pandemia no afectaría directamente a los sistemas de TI" fue criticado con humor por no tener en cuenta los RFC 1149 y RFC 2549 en su análisis. [6]
Los riesgos conocidos del protocolo incluyen:
Los fotógrafos de rafting ya utilizan palomas como una red de seguridad para transportar fotos digitales en soportes flash desde la cámara hasta el operador turístico. [7] En una distancia de 30 millas (48 km), una sola paloma puede transportar decenas de gigabytes de datos en aproximadamente una hora, lo que, en términos de ancho de banda promedio, se compara muy favorablemente con los estándares ADSL actuales , incluso si se tienen en cuenta las unidades perdidas. [8]
El 12 de marzo de 2004, Yossi Vardi , Ami Ben-Bassat y Guy Vardi enviaron tres palomas mensajeras a una distancia de 100 kilómetros (62 millas), "cada una con 20-22 pequeñas tarjetas de memoria que contenían 1,3 GB, lo que sumaba un total de 4 GB de datos". Se logró un rendimiento efectivo de 2,27 Mbps. El propósito de la prueba era medir y confirmar una mejora con respecto a RFC 2549. [8] Dado que los desarrolladores utilizaron memoria flash en lugar de notas de papel como se especifica en RFC 2549, el experimento fue ampliamente criticado como un ejemplo en el que una implementación optimizada rompe un estándar oficial. [ cita requerida ]
El 9 de septiembre de 2009, inspirados por el RFC 2549, el equipo de marketing de The Unlimited, una empresa regional de Sudáfrica, decidió organizar una carrera de palomas entre su paloma mascota Winston y la empresa de telecomunicaciones local Telkom SA . La carrera consistía en enviar 4 gigabytes de datos desde Howick a Hillcrest , a aproximadamente 60 kilómetros de distancia. La paloma llevaba una tarjeta microSD y competía contra una línea ADSL de Telkom. [9] Winston superó la transferencia de datos a través de la línea ADSL de Telkom, con un tiempo total de dos horas, seis minutos y 57 segundos desde la carga de datos en la tarjeta microSD hasta la finalización de la descarga desde la tarjeta. En el momento de la victoria de Winston, la transferencia ADSL estaba completa en un 4 %. [10] [11] [12]
En noviembre de 2009, el programa de televisión australiano de comedia y actualidad Hungry Beast repitió este experimento. El equipo de Hungry Beast aceptó el desafío después de una acalorada sesión parlamentaria en la que el gobierno de la época criticó a la oposición por no apoyar las inversiones en telecomunicaciones, diciendo que si la oposición se saliera con la suya, los australianos estarían haciendo transferencias de datos a través de palomas mensajeras. El equipo de Hungry Beast había leído sobre el experimento sudafricano y supuso que, como país occidental desarrollado , Australia tendría velocidades más altas. El experimento hizo que el equipo transfiriera un archivo de 700 MB a través de tres métodos de entrega para determinar cuál era el más rápido: una paloma mensajera con una tarjeta microSD, un automóvil que llevara una memoria USB y una línea ADSL de Telstra (el proveedor de telecomunicaciones más grande de Australia). Los datos se transferirían desde Tarana en la zona rural de Nueva Gales del Sur hasta el suburbio de Prospect, en el oeste de Sydney , Nueva Gales del Sur , una distancia de 132 kilómetros (82 millas) por carretera. Aproximadamente a la mitad de la carrera, la conexión a Internet se cayó inesperadamente y la transferencia tuvo que reiniciarse. La paloma ganó la carrera con un tiempo de aproximadamente 1 hora y 5 minutos, el auto quedó en segundo lugar con 2 horas y 10 minutos, mientras que la transferencia de Internet no terminó, habiéndose cortado una segunda vez y no habiendo regresado. El tiempo estimado para completar la carga en un momento fue tan alto como 9 horas, y en ningún momento el tiempo estimado de carga cayó por debajo de las 4 horas. [13]
En septiembre de 2010, el bloguero tecnológico (trefor.net) y director de tecnología del proveedor de servicios de Internet Timico, Trefor Davies, organizó una carrera de palomas similar con la granjera Michelle Brumfield en la zona rural de Yorkshire, Inglaterra : entregaron un video de cinco minutos a un corresponsal de la BBC a 75 millas de distancia, en Skegness . La paloma (que llevaba una tarjeta de memoria con un video HD de 300 MB de Davies cortándose el pelo) compitió contra una subida a YouTube a través de la banda ancha de British Telecom ; la paloma fue liberada a las 11:05 am y llegó al palomar una hora y quince minutos después, mientras que la subida aún estaba incompleta, tras haber fallado una vez en el ínterin. [14] [15] [16]
J'avais été choquée, monsieur le ministre, de vous entender parler de pigeons voyageurs, mais, finalement, vous aviez peut-être raison. Il existe en efecto una norma, la norma RFC 1149, que data del 1 de abril de 1990, bien que ce n'est pas un poisson d'avril (Sourires), que décrit comentario sobre puede hacer una transmisión por Internet por paloma viajera. Neuf paquets de données ont été enviados.